Advanced oxidation process (AOP) with hydroxyl radicals (OH) is considered to be useful for water purification through oxidation; therefore, we proposed a useful passing water-type ozonizer, which could generate discharges even on the liquid surface. We first observed optical emissions due to the discharges and then confirmed the existence of O and OH radicals. Next, decomposition of Methylene Blue was examined. When the discharge was generated between a glass electrode and liquid, the AOP was achieved. The obtained results also indicated that various decomposition and treatment would be possible by selecting discharge form for our passing water-type ozonizer.
